In this episode of the Introvert Ally podcast series, the host welcomes Dr. Christopher Lee, an esteemed colleague and expert in human resources. Dr. Lee shares his journey of identifying as an introvert and how this self-awareness has influenced his leadership style and professional decisions. Discussing his diverse experiences in the military and academic sectors, he emphasizes the importance of recognizing and leveraging one's natural disposition for personal and team success. Dr. Lee also introduces his book 'Performance Conversations,' which advocates for a coaching-based approach to performance management, highlighting its benefits for both introverts and extroverts. The episode delves into the nuances of recruitment, performance management, and the evolving role of AI in hiring processes, making a compelling case for a more human-centered, strengths-based approach in professional environments.
